Is Dick Barrie still involved in the sport? He was always ready to wind up the opposition and add spice to a meeting! 'Uncle' Len once questioned Dick's patriotism when Dick was presenting a Test match between England and the USA at Poole. Len was moaning at Dick's impartiality and that he wasn't taking the side of England. Len said "Where's your national pride?" to which Dick replied "Back up in Scotland where it belongs!" announcing it all those present!

Just been looking thru' the wonderful images of Wimbledon Riders (earlier thread) and Tommy Jansson had it all. Good looks and a style on a bike to match. I last saw him ride at Swindon in 1976 competing in a Golden Helmet encounter with Martin Ashby and although loosing the tie he was just poetry in motion. A rider who had everything but his life was cut short during that awful night of the 20th May 1976 when he was killed competing in a world championship meeting in Sweden. I remember waking up to the news and feeling numb. Would he eventually have become World Individual Champion (he was already a twice Pairs World Champion)? We'll never know but my guess would have been a resounding yes! Gone but never forgotten. PS The book on Tommy's life is well worth a read.

One of my last experiences of Billy was at Cowley (1984) on the occasion when he just rode straight thru' the tapes because a decision had gone against him! Last time I saw him ride was at Swindon (1985) which may have been his last ever meeting (?). Of course none of us knew what was about to happen and he was/is sadly missed. Reminds me, also, when in 1973 Belle Vue visited Cowley and a decision went against Alan Wilkinson (another character) and he strode from the pits and tore the tapes out of its sockets! As you can imagine the crowd went wild!

I've purposely tried to take a back seat regarding this particular subject because of all the abuse and finger pointing that any comment against the Play-Off system from certain quarters generate but... It's no secret (well chronicled elsewhere) that I gave up attending speedway in 2003 thru' various reasons but mainly due to re-location. My team (Oxford) won the last traditional championship in 2001 after a very closely fought season long battle with Poole. The matches all season long were well supported because we felt we had a team that would be challenging for the title. The next season (2002) it was decided to re-structure the league format and hold play-offs to decide the league champions. Oxford were denied an opportunity to defend their title because SKY had decided that the 'qualifying' matches should be completed by the end of August. However, Oxford's visit to Peterborough didn't take place as it fell outside that remit. If Oxford had won that match they would have claimed the last play-off spot however Peterborough 'qualified' instead (even though one could argue that they were at fault for not running the fixture within the agreed time scale). Hence why my enthusiasm began to wain (although to be fair it had been on the decline for a number of years). I have no interest in the economies of play-offs as I haven't access to such figures and it's beyond my remit and, to be frank, my interest as I no longer attend matches. I'll let those who still have a vestige interest in the sport to 'discuss' the pros and cons but my underlying feeling of play-offs are in the negative due to the irregularities of its initial inception and the fact that my team was denied an opportunity to defend their title thru' no fault of their making! -
